Hidehiro Kaneda has authored 205 papers that have received a total of 2.5k indexed citations.
This includes 157 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 42 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 41 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. The topics of these papers are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(100 papers),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(95 papers) and Galaxies: Formation, Evolution, Phenomena (63 papers). Hidehiro Kaneda is often cited by papers focused on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(100 papers),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(95 papers) and Galaxies: Formation, Evolution, Phenomena (63 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Germany and United States. Hidehiro Kaneda's co-authors include Takashi Onaka, Itsuki Sakon, Takao Nakagawa, Daisuke Ishihara and Kazuo Makishima and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, The Astrophysical Journal and Monthly Notices of the Royal Astronomical Society
